Creatives are the future! I’ve always been inspired by artists that are self-taught & strive to teach others. It’s a beautiful act of love passed on by hard work & perseverance. Meet Italian Youtuber and Make-up Artist, Roberta Tagliafierro –
“I think that the best way to describe what I do is just makeup practice and emotions. I try something new in every look I create and that helps me improve my skills. I just let my creativity and imagination go and my hands do the rest drawing lines and blending colours. I like thinking that my makeup work speak for themselves and everyone can see in them the meaning or the emotion they want to see. If I should describe myself in one world it would be nocturnal. I love the night because it’s such a special and magic part of the day; the peace and relax it brings to me are just perfect to create and express myself. I’m able to come up with ideas and I feel so much more inspired. All this helps me to concentrate on what I really want to do and to reach and accomplish that. Moreover I love vampires and staying up all night just makes me feel like one them lol.
I love sharing my artistry because I would love to be able to inspire other people to do what they love to express their inner beauty and to improve, to try something new and maybe discover themselves a little more. I grew a lot since I started doing makeup at an artistic level and I feel confident about myself because I’m finally starting to know better what I like and what I am. I’m finally able to see the beauty in others and in what surrounds me, and that’s the most precious thing this works taught me. I think that the best traits of my personality that helped me are being passionate, precise and self-control, even though the last one refers more to the real working aspect of my life. But also a ton of bad traits helped me get were I am: stubbornness and perfectionism are just two of them.
My journey began right after high school. I started doing YouTube videos and Instagram makeup posts. After a month I was studying in MUD academy in Milan to get my certificate as makeup artist. In a certain way I wanted to grow in every direction, both professionally and on social media, because this last one has come to be one of the best way to advertise your own self. Of course I started doing makeup way before, but I discovered that it was what really made me happy at 14/15 years. From that age I wore makeup every single day to school and I experimented and learned a lot, getting better and better in precise lines. My favourite part was doing my eyeliner and brows, and it’s still the same today. Now I work as a freelance in Milan and I keep studying makeup on my own, taking inspiration from wonderful artists I continuously find on Instagram.
I totally think that my makeup style is a reflection of my personality. I’m always changing mood and colours express that. However there will always be that precise liner or super defined brow that marks my works. I think my lifestyle is all about good vibes and taking things easy. I try to focus on what I love and on doing it in the best way I can. In the meanwhile I also try to keep up with everything surrounding me, such as university (I study Math but I find it to be way difficult than what I expected, since what I hated about that subject in high school is the base of every single course I have), collaborations and work. But as I said, I take things easy and try not to stress out. In the end I think that only what makes you happy and fulfilled really matters.” – Roberta Tagliafierro.
